2000 Honda Passport Transmission

    The 2000 Honda Passport is a reliable and well-loved SUV by many consumers. However, one common issue that has been reported by owners is problems with the transmission. The transmission is a vital component of any vehicle, and when it starts to fail, it can be a costly and frustrating problem to deal with.

    Many owners of the 2000 Honda Passport have reported issues with the transmission slipping, jerking, or failing altogether. This can lead to a loss of power, difficulty shifting gears, and in some cases, complete transmission failure. The issue seems to be most prevalent in vehicles with higher mileage, but even those with lower mileage have experienced transmission problems.

    One of the main reasons for these transmission issues in the 2000 Honda Passport is a design flaw in the transmission system. The transmission is not able to handle the power of the engine, leading to overheating and eventual failure. This flaw has led to many owners having to replace their entire transmission, costing thousands of dollars in repairs.
